Dallas is a major city in North Texas, located in the south west of the United States. If you are travelling in summer, Dallas is one of the hottest cities in its region in the United States, expect temperatures well over 38° with warm and dry winds. However winter is still usually mild with temperatures ranging between 13° and 21°C. If you are after a total entertainment experience of shopping and dining, then the popular Uptown District is filled with new residential and retail centre’s that will appeal to everyone no matter your taste. Dallas has an abundance of luscious parks, over 400 in fact; however it is Fair Park that is home to the Dallas Zoo, Texas’ first and largest zoo which opened its doors in 1888 on that exact site. For those inquisitive tourists who really want to explore all aspects of Dallas then it is worth a visit to the Dallas Tourist Information Centre, which is located in the Old Red Courthouse, in the Downtown Historic District. Here any one of the staff can assist you with questions or help you find information about activities or attractions in the area and beyond. The centre features interactive touch screen stations, internet access and has continuous video presentations about the historical and cultural nature of Dallas. Take a leisurely stroll through the open-air Dallas Farmers Market, it’s open 7 days a week and is a great opportunity to interact with the locals and experience their mouth watering produce which includes fresh fruit and vegetables, herbs and floral plants.
